Why Mr. Vendor Sounds Different-Korede Bello

Korede Bello has reacted to the criticism that has trailed his new single, Mr. Vendor.
The artist recently released Mr. Vendor after a period of being musically silent.
Reacting to criticisms from fans who felt that the song was different from his typical sound, he explained that he was trying not to be boxed into making a particular kind of song.
“The issue is not with the music but the fact some people can’t stop seeing me through ‘Godwin’ eyes. I make music for a diverse audience and I refuse to be boxed in one folder,” the Romantic singer said.
